Troubleshooting

The add-on doesn’t appear in the Extensions menu

The add-on lives in the Extensions menu in Google Slides’ top menu bar. If it’s missing, reload the browser tab — a document that was already open when you installed the add-on won’t show it until refreshed. Also make sure you’re signed in with the same Google account you used to install it.

On a work or school account, your Workspace administrator may need to allow the add-on before it shows up.

The sidebar is blank or stuck loading

This is almost always caused by being signed in to several Google accounts at once — Google may then run the add-on under the wrong account. Sign out of the other accounts, or open the document in an incognito window (or a browser profile) with only one account, and try again.

Also check that your browser or an extension isn’t blocking pop-ups or third-party cookies — the sidebar needs them to load.

The add-on stopped working or shows an error

A clean reinstall fixes most problems:

  1. In the document, open Extensions → Add-ons → Manage add-ons and uninstall the add-on.
  2. In your Google account permissions, remove the add-on’s access to reset its authorization.
  3. Reinstall it from the Google Workspace Marketplace and authorize it again.

Frequently asked questions

What does the “Organize” / auto-layout feature do?
It stacks your selected objects into a clean row or column with a consistent gap, anchored to any of nine points via a 3×3 grid, so you can rebuild a tidy layout in one click.
Can I make several objects the same size?
Yes. Copy the size from one object and apply width, height, or both to any number of others.
What are spacing tokens?
A reusable spacing scale (16, 24, 32 pt by default, fully editable) so every gap in your deck follows the same system. Your tokens are saved between sessions.

What is Grid Layout?
Grid Layout snaps your selected objects into a grid you define — columns, rows, gap and margin. Pick the exact cells to fill, save grids as reusable presets, and apply in one click. Images keep their aspect ratio; grouped objects scale without distortion.
